''The Presidents of the United States: 1789-1894'' is a comprehensive book written by James Grant Wilson, which provides a detailed account of the first 23 presidents of the United States. The book starts with George Washington, the first president of the United States, and ends with Benjamin Harrison, the 23rd president. The book covers each president’s life, career, and accomplishments during their time in office. It also includes information about their personal lives, including their families, hobbies, and interests. The author provides insights into the challenges each president faced during their tenure, including wars, economic crises, and political scandals.
